Definition of Nonmetallic Gasket Market:
The Nonmetallic Gasket Market encompasses the production, distribution, and application of sealing devices crafted from materials other than metals. These gaskets are designed to create a static seal between two surfaces, preventing the leakage of liquids, gases, or other media. The market includes a diverse range of products, catering to various industries and application needs.
The primary components of the Nonmetallic Gasket Market include a wide array of materials, such as elastomers (e.g., rubber, silicone, EPDM), compressed fiber, PTFE (Teflon), graphite, and plastic-based materials. Each material offers distinct properties, making them suitable for specific operating conditions and applications. Key services associated with the market include custom gasket design, material selection, and technical support to ensure optimal sealing performance. Systems involved include the manufacturing processes and distribution networks necessary to bring these gaskets to market.
Key terms related to the Nonmetallic Gasket Market include: Sealing, Static Seal, Elastomer, Compression Set, Tensile Strength, Chemical Resistance, Temperature Resistance, and Flange. Sealing refers to the process of creating a leak-proof barrier. A static seal is a seal between two surfaces that do not move relative to each other. Elastomers are polymers with elastic properties. Compression set is the permanent deformation of a material after it has been subjected to a compressive load. Tensile strength is the maximum stress that a material can withstand while being stretched before breaking. Chemical resistance is the ability of a material to withstand degradation from exposure to chemicals. Temperature resistance is the ability of a material to maintain its properties at high or low temperatures. Flange is a projecting rim or collar used to connect pipes or other objects.

By Type:
The Nonmetallic Gasket Market, based on type, includes elastomeric gaskets, compressed fiber gaskets, PTFE gaskets, graphite gaskets, and other specialty gaskets.
Elastomeric Gaskets: These gaskets are made from rubber or elastomer-based materials like EPDM, silicone, or nitrile rubber. They are known for their flexibility, compressibility, and ability to conform to uneven surfaces. Elastomeric gaskets are widely used in applications requiring a tight seal at relatively low pressures and temperatures.
Compressed Fiber Gaskets: These gaskets are manufactured from compressed fibers, often combined with binders or fillers. They offer good resistance to chemicals and high temperatures and are commonly used in applications involving steam, water, and oil.
PTFE Gaskets: These gaskets are made from PTFE (Teflon) materials, known for their exceptional chemical resistance and low friction properties. They are ideal for applications involving corrosive fluids and high temperatures.
Graphite Gaskets: These gaskets are made from graphite materials, offering excellent resistance to high temperatures and pressures. They are commonly used in applications involving steam, chemicals, and high-temperature fluids.
Other Specialty Gaskets: This segment includes gaskets made from specialized materials or designed for specific applications, such as spiral-wound gaskets, metal-jacketed gaskets, and corrugated gaskets.

The technology used for Nonmetallic Gasket Market is constantly evolving, with new materials, manufacturing processes, and design techniques being developed to improve gasket performance and reliability. Key technologies include advanced material formulation, precision molding techniques, and computer-aided design (CAD) and finite element analysis (FEA). These technologies enable manufacturers to develop gaskets that meet the demanding requirements of various industries and applications.
Advanced material formulation involves the development of new gasket compounds with enhanced resistance to chemicals, high temperatures, and pressures. Precision molding techniques, such as injection molding and compression molding, enable the production of gaskets with tight tolerances and complex geometries. CAD and FEA software are used to design and analyze gaskets, optimizing their performance and ensuring their reliability under various operating conditions.
Other key technologies in the Nonmetallic Gasket Market include laser cutting, waterjet cutting, and automated inspection systems. Laser cutting and waterjet cutting provide precise and efficient methods for cutting gaskets from various materials. Automated inspection systems use sensors and vision systems to ensure the quality and dimensional accuracy of finished gaskets.
